Output ec364eaa3734718d9b2afaa912399e4570c34ff8c98e5cce68a64fea3018277c:3

value
399492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f26c1e3e26d72e681a0dc0fcfb752fedca891c OP_EQUAL
address
3BAdw6qkjvSsQZTqL4QJnXCxJFW62G49xS
transaction
ec364eaa3734718d9b2afaa912399e4570c34ff8c98e5cce68a64fea3018277c